FAQs
- What should the customer know about your pricing (e.g., discounts, fees)?
We work on a contingency fee basis, which means our clients don’t pay any upfront costs or hourly fees. We only get paid if we successfully recover compensation on your behalf. This allows clients to pursue their case without financial stress or risk. During your consultation, we’ll clearly explain how fees work so there are no surprises.
- What is your typical process for working with a new customer?
We start with a free consultation to understand the details of your situation and determine how we can help. If we move forward together, our team immediately begins investigating your case—gathering evidence, reviewing medical records, and communicating with insurance companies. We handle the legal process from start to finish, keeping you informed along the way, so you can focus on your recovery.
